Discount Generic Omeprazole: Your Practical Guide to Saving Money

Omeprazole is one of the most common medicines for heartburn and acid reflux. The brand version can be pricey, but the generic version works just as well for far less. If you’re hunting for a discount, you need a simple plan that protects your health while keeping your wallet happy.

Where to Find Reliable Discount Sources

Start by checking reputable online pharmacies that require a prescription. Look for sites that display a valid pharmacy license, a clear contact address, and a pharmacist‑in‑charge badge. Big pharmacy chains often have a “generic discount” section, and many offer coupon codes that shave 10‑30% off the listed price. Compare at least three sources before you click ‘buy’—the difference can add up quickly.

Don’t ignore local options. Community health clinics sometimes sell generic omeprazole at wholesale rates, especially for patients with low income. If you have insurance, ask your plan if they cover the generic version; many plans treat it the same as the brand but charge a lower copay.

Safety Checklist Before Purchasing

1. Verify the pharmacy’s license. In the U.S., you can search the FDA’s Verified Internet Pharmacy Practice Sites list. 2. Make sure the product description includes the strength (usually 20 mg) and the amount you need. 3. Check for a batch number and expiration date—legitimate sellers won’t hide these details.

4. Read customer reviews, but focus on comments about product authenticity, not just shipping speed. 5. Use a secure payment method; credit cards often provide extra protection against fraud.

When a deal looks too good to be true, it probably is. Ultra‑low prices might mean the pills are counterfeit, expired, or stored improperly, which can reduce effectiveness or cause side effects.

Once you receive your omeprazole, store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. The typical dose is once daily before a meal, but follow your doctor’s instructions. If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ember unless it’s almost time for the next one.

Common side effects include headache, mild stomach cramps, or a temporary metallic taste. These usually fade after a few days. If you notice severe rash, swelling, or persistent diarrhea, stop the medication and call your healthcare provider right away.
